Analysis

In 2025, gross intake ratio to the last grade of primary education, adjusted in Gambia stood at 1.19 GPIA. That is the highest value across all 49 years on record.

Compared with earlier readings it is up 0.5% on the previous year and up 11.1% over ten years.

Over the whole period, gross intake ratio to the last grade of primary education, adjusted in Gambia peaked at 1.19 GPIA in 2025 and was at its lowest, 0.3844 GPIA, in 1972.

Gambia ranks 5th of 194 countries on this measure, in the top 10%.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 49 years of available data.

Gambia compared with similar countries

  • Gambia's 1.19 GPIA is above the median for low income countries, which is 0.992 GPIA, 1.2× the median. (22 countries reporting)
  • Gambia's 1.19 GPIA is above the median for Sub-Saharan Africa, which is 1.02 GPIA, 1.2× the median. (46 countries reporting)
